What it does

This workflow watches your category's search terms daily, compares today's Brave Search result counts against a stored rolling baseline, and fires a Slack alert the moment a term breaks out well above its normal range. It turns slow weekly review into a same-day breakout signal.

When to use it

Use it when timing matters — a competitor launch, a viral feature name, a sudden regulatory term — and a weekly brief would be too late. Ideal for growth, comms, and competitive-intel teams who already live in Slack.

How it works

  1. 1A daily schedule triggers the sweep.
  2. 2Brave Search returns current result volume and top snippets for each tracked term.
  3. 3A logic step computes each term's deviation from its rolling baseline and flags spikes past the threshold.
  4. 4An OpenAI step writes a one-paragraph context note explaining likely drivers for each spiking term.
  5. 5A Slack step posts the alert with term, spike magnitude, and the context note to your channel.
